Release Note
Abstract​
Bigstack CubeCOS 2.2.0 is a major release for CubeCOS cloud operating system. This release provides the following updates to Bigstack CubeCOS version 2.1.0:
New functionality​
- Cloud Computing
- Auto-scaling: OpenStack Senlin
- Infrastructure Optimization: OpenStack Watcher
- Storage
- Dedicated SSD Pool: For consistent performance characteristics
- Storage Node Group: For serving various capabilities across storage nodes
- Networking and Network Security
- Site-to-Site IPsec VPN-as-a-Service
- Enhancements and more feature support on Load Balancers
- Abnormal Flow Detection with alerts
- VM Ping Health Check from monitoring
- Hybrid Cloud Management
- Integration with ManageIQ, capable for additional cloud providers
- Operation and Management
- Multi-cluster Console: To manage multiple Cube clusters in a single place
- Custom SSO Portal: For more services with Single Sign-On integration
- New Notification Type (Executable): To provide a flexible way for service integration outside Cube - Sending alerts via webhook, syslog, or snmp trap, etc
- API Gateway: One Place to Manage All API Services
- Device Monitor: To monitor Devices outside Cube Platform
Enhancements​
- Upgraded OpenStack to Wallaby
- Upgraded Ceph to v16 pacific
- Added support of individual mirrored volume on promotion/demotion
- Added support of UEFI VM images
- Changed image upload path from /var/support to /mnt/cephfs for more capacity
- Added Chassis monitoring in Host panel - Temperature, fan speed, etc
Changed features​
There is no changed feature in this release.
Fixed defects​
- Bug Fixes since Cube 2.1.0, including fixpacks and hotfixes.
Fixpacks​
Enhancements and fixes in Cube 2.2.1​
- Added CLI options to allow add/remove ssdpool in specified group
- Added service validation on DNS and Time services
Enhancements and fixes in Cube 2.2.2​
- Added login banner and node/cluster information in Cube local console
- CVE-2021-44228 Log4Shell - Remote Code Execution - log4j
- Added image import and instance export functions on LMI
- Replaced conventional device names with UUID boot
- Refined Email format for notifications
- Added support of applying fixpack to all cluster nodes
Enhancements and fixes in Cube 2.2.3​
- HybridCloud removal
- Removed the HybridCloud feature, i.e. ManageIQ
- CVE-2021-45046 - Mitigated CubeCOS components subject to CVE-2021-44228 Log4Shell - Remote Code Execution
- Enhancement of virtual machine provisioning
- Enhancement of retention policies for InfluxDB
Announcement​
The Bigstack CubeCOS cloud operating system version 2.2.0 is generally available in October, 2021.
Operating Software​
- CentOS 8 Stream
OpenStack Version​
- Wallaby Release (April 2021 / OpenStack 23rd release)
OpenStack Services​
Web Frontend​
- Horizon (Dashboard)
Share Services​
- Keystone (Identity)
- Glance (Image)
- Barbican (Key Store)
Compute​
- Nova (Virtual Machine)
- Ironic (Bare-metal)
Networking​
- Neutron (SDN/NFV, VPN as a Service)
- Octavia (Load Balance as a Service)
- Designate (DNS as a Service)
Storage​
- Cinder (Block Storage)
- Manila (File Storage)
- Swift (Object Storage)
Orchestration​
- Heat (Orchestration)
- Senlin (Auto-scaling)
- Mistral (Workflow as a Service)
Monitoring​
- Monasca (Telemetry)
Application Lifecycle​
- Masakari (Instance HA)
- Freezer (Schedule Backup)
- Murano (App Catalog/Marketplace)
Billing​
- Cloudkitty (Rating as a Service)
Resource Optimaztion​
- Watcher (Infrastructure Optimization)